引言
随着移动互联网的快速发展,越来越多的用户通过不同的设备访问网页。为了满足这一需求,跨平台网页应用开发变得尤为重要。本文将详细介绍跨平台网页应用开发的技术、技巧和工具,帮助您轻松驾驭多终端,打造无处不在的应用。
跨平台网页应用开发概述
1. 跨平台网页应用的定义
跨平台网页应用是指可以在不同的操作系统和设备上运行的应用程序,主要包括Windows、macOS、iOS、Android等。这类应用通过Web技术实现,如HTML、CSS和JavaScript。
2. 跨平台网页应用的优势
- 开发成本较低:相比原生应用,跨平台应用的开发周期和成本较低。
- 快速迭代:支持快速更新和迭代,满足用户需求。
- 一次开发,多端运行:适用于多终端,无需针对不同平台分别开发。
跨平台网页应用开发技术
1. HTML
HTML是网页内容的基础,负责页面结构和布局。在跨平台网页应用开发中,需要遵循W3C标准,确保页面在不同浏览器和设备上具有良好的兼容性。
2. CSS
CSS用于设置网页样式,包括颜色、字体、布局等。通过CSS3,开发者可以实现对动画、阴影、圆角等效果的实现,进一步提升用户体验。
3. JavaScript
JavaScript是网页编程语言,用于实现网页的交互功能。在跨平台网页应用开发中,JavaScript负责与服务器交互、处理用户操作等。
4. 前端框架
为了提高开发效率和代码质量,许多前端框架应运而生,如React、Vue和Angular。这些框架提供了组件化、模块化的开发方式,有助于实现跨平台应用。
高效编程技巧
1. 利用构建工具
构建工具如Webpack、Gulp等可以帮助开发者自动化构建过程,提高开发效率。通过配置构建流程,可以实现代码压缩、合并、预处理等操作。
// 使用Webpack配置文件
module.exports = {
entry: './src/index.js',
output: {
filename: 'bundle.js',
path: __dirname + '/dist'
},
module: {
rules: [
{
test: /\.js$/,
exclude: /node_modules/,
use: {
loader: 'babel-loader',
options: {
presets: ['@babel/preset-env']
}
}
}
]
}
};
2. 使用版本控制工具
版本控制工具如Git可以帮助开发者管理代码变更、多人协作和代码回滚等。通过合理的分支策略和代码审查机制,确保代码质量和协作效率。
3. 代码规范
遵循代码规范可以提升团队协作效率,降低代码维护成本。常见的代码规范包括Prettier、ESLint等。
总结
跨平台网页应用开发是实现多终端适配的有效途径。通过掌握相关技术和技巧,开发者可以轻松驾驭多终端,打造无处不在的应用。希望本文能为您提供一些有价值的参考。
